Atascadero Lakeside Wine Festival will be hosted at Atascadero Lake Park on Saturday, June 23, 2012. This signature event brings together more
than 80 wineries, and a dozen chefs offering their renowned wines and food for tasting and sampling. You'll have a unique opportunity to speak with winemakers and vineyard owners about the wine and history of the wine experience. An exclusive artist's showcase will be infused throughout the lakeside venue and live music will compliment your wine tasting experience.
The Atascadero Lakeside Wine Festival is presented by a group of dedicated volunteers. Beneficiaries of the event include Atascadero's Charles Paddock Zoo and local community projects.
